Über diesen Ort G San Francisco Hotel

Das Hotel G San Francisco bietet LGBTQ+-Reisenden eine einladende Basis in einer der ikonischsten, schwulenfreundlichen Städte Amerikas. An der Geary Street gelegen, befindet sich dieses Gay-Hotel mitten im Geschehen von San Francisco – nur einen Block vom Union Square und den historischen Cable Cars entfernt, drei Blocks vom BART-Transit und nur einen kurzen Spaziergang von wichtigen Sehenswürdigkeiten wie dem MOMA, dem Financial District und dem Moscone Center entfernt. Das Hotel bietet praktische Annehmlichkeiten für Ihren Aufenthalt, darunter ein 24/7-Fitnesscenter und WLAN in den Lobbys. Die Gästezimmer sind auf Komfort während Ihres Besuchs in San Francisco ausgelegt, egal ob Sie zum Pride-Fest, zur Erkundung der lebendigen LGBTQ+-Viertel der Stadt oder einfach nur, um eines der fortschrittlichsten Reiseziele der Welt zu erleben, hier sind. We stayed here for an event and found the experience to be average overall. Parts of the hotel appeared to be under renovation, and the temporary drapes and barriers made it feel somewhat unfinished and confusing to navigate. We booked a Studio Suite, but it felt quite small—many hotels would market a room of this size as a standard guest room rather than a suite. The windows were noticeably dirty, and the room itself felt plain and lacking warmth or character. On the positive side, the staff were pleasant, responsive, and helpful throughout our stay. While the location is convenient, there are several better hotel options in San Francisco at similar price points. Based on this experience, I would choose to stay elsewhere on a future visit.

My wife and I stayed in a Great King room Fri-6/5 thru Mon-6/8. It's an older historic building but the room was clean with a great view and a fair value for the price considering adjacent hotels. The paid parking next door was convenient and we felt comfortable with the parking attendants. The only thing is the customer service kind of sucked. Friday night we had no issues but Saturday afternoon the lights in the bathroom went out. The recessed can light above the shower and the bulb over the mirror died so at night the bathroom was completely dark. I mentioned it to the staff Saturday afternoon and they said that they were sending someone to fix it but nobody came. Sunday I asked again but they kind of treated me like an idiot and explained in annoyingly slow and patronizing speech how a motion sensor switch works. I'm not elderly I know how a motion sensor switch works. They were doing construction in the room above and I think they caused a short or something because Saturday morning the bathroom lights went out completely and the bathroom switch started turning the closet lightbulb on and off instead. My wife and I laughed about this as one of those quirky things that happens but the hotel staff just didn't care to do anything about it. I took showers in the dark Saturday and Sunday night with a little bit of the city lights from the bathroom window. I thought they would at least offer to move us to a different room with working lights but they did nothing. At checkout I mentioned this to a different desk manager, I think her name was Claudia? She sort of turned it back on me and said "Why didn't you let us know?" I said I did, twice. Then she just asked "Was it a man you asked?" It was. She seemed to have some sort of a personal vendetta with the guy working the desk and was glad I told her something she could get him in trouble for, but she didn't seem to care at all about how that impacted our stay and really didn't offer anything or even say sorry for the inconvenience. It's not a huge deal, but it did show me that the staff here really doesn't care about customer service very much. Still the room was great (besides the dark bathroom), the housekeeping staff was very nice dare I say stellar, and the rates were fair. I don't know if I'd stay here again just because the desk managers seemed annoyed by my existence, but I really did have a wonderful time visiting San Francisco (dark bathroom and all).
